Go for a snorkel at Hanauma Bay, one of the most popular natural attractions in the world! You'll spot schools of colorful fish and perhaps even dolphins and turtles. The safe inner reef is perfect for children and beginners, while the more challenging outer reef will thrill advanced snorkelers.

Hanauma Bay Nature Preserve is a natural crescent beach in the sunken caldera of an extinct volcano. The bay is protected by the volcanic formation and the waters are famously clear, providing the ideal environment to spot fish and other marine wildlife.

The City and County of Honolulu's Marine Educational Center at Hanauma Bay features marine displays of wildlife in the bay, an educational video theater and other facilities. It's mandatory that you watch the video in order to be informed about the bay's geological and historical background, and the importance of protecting Hanauma Bay for future visitors.

The Coral Island, locally called Koh Tan, is a primitive tranquil island and spans an area is 7.5 square kilometers.

The island is considered to be the neighboring island of Koh Samui. On the island lies a small pristine village and there is neither car nor road. The island, surrounded by coral reef with serene white sandy beaches, offers a perfect spot for snorkeling and sun-bathing.

This tour will take you by local boat from the Thong Tanot pier out to Koh Tan where you can play Robinson Crusoe! Local legend has it that this island is bewitched and as such no dog can live there! There is time here for swimming, snorkeling and sunbathing before heading onto the next island Koh Mus-sum. Lunch is served at a local restaurant.

Head out to the most famous snorkel spot in Aruba, "the Antilla Ship Wreck", aboard a luxury catamaran. Dip your mask underwater, kick your fins, and discover the 400-foot (122 meters) long wreck, which is now home to a variety of tropical fish and colorful coral. Along the way, you'll also stop at Catalina Bay - ideal for beginner snorkelers.

At Catalina Bay, a nice shallow area ideal for those who have not snorkeled in a long time, you will explore the shallow waters and enjoy a variety of colorful tropical fish and several species of corals.

Then onto the famous Antilla Ship Wreck, a 400 ft. (122 meters) long German freighter resting in 60 ft. (18 meters) of water. When the Germans invaded Holland during World War ll, this German freighter was scuttled by its Captain on purpose to avoid confiscation by the Dutch in Aruba. The wreck is now the new home to exotic fish and corals. Fish include: The Parrot Fish, Barracudas, Fresh Angel Fish, Yellow Tail Snapper, Grunt, Blue Tang, Butterfly Fish, Green Moray , Puffer Fish, Sergeant Mayor, Southern Stingray, Queen Flounder, Stoplight Parrotfish and Trumpet Fish.

Snorkeling at Los Arcos is one of the most popular tourist activities and it's not hard to see why! Nature has provided wonderful scenic surroundings for your snorkeling expedition, with arches and caves that have been sculpted by the forge of the ocean for thousands of years!

Departing from the Puerto Vallarta Marina, your friendly crew will have breakfast ready for you as the catamaran passes close to the shoreline, with views of downtown Puerto Vallarta.

Snorkel approximately 330 feet (100 meters) offshore in the warm and scenic bay of Los Arcos, otherwise known as 'The Arches', where granite rock formations of arches and caves have been sculpted by the forge of the ocean. All things natural are protected here so that you can have the amazing opportunity to snorkel in a rare environment and explore the brightly colored fish and steep rock walls that engulf this marine area.
